This course serves as a foundational introduction to the behavior of electrical circuits, targeting beginners who want to learn essential concepts in electronics. It starts with Ohm's law and progresses through various circuit analysis methods, covering topics like resistor circuits, Kirchhoff's laws, and network theorems. With a combination of lectures and self-study materials, students will gain the knowledge needed to understand and discuss electrical engineering concepts confidently.
What you'll learn
understand and apply Ohm's law
analyze resistor circuits
identify and convert voltage and current sources
apply Kirchhoff's voltage and current laws
practice nodal analysis
calculate power, current, and voltage
explain and use the Norton and Thevenin equivalent circuits
